Wolf Furniture's Ed Basore To Retire

Furniture World News Desk on 3/24/2015


  

Ed Basore & David Dumm


Ed Basore, Casegoods & Bedding Buyer for Wolf Furniture, has announced that he will be retiring shortly after the April High Point Market. Ed has worked for Wolf’s in a number of capacities, including sales, store management, distribution manager and buyer.

“Ed’s dedication and attention to service and detail are a rare trait. He has had a terrific career here,” said Gene Stoltz. “We are so happy that he is able to do this. He has been a tremendous asset to Wolf’s for 32 years, and has always stepped forward to do whatever was asked of him.” Doug Wolf added, “Ed has been an integral part of Wolf’s management team. Back when he & I ran a store, he bailed me out of many jams. We were a good team for decades. He will be missed.”

With Ed Basore’s retirement comes the promotion of David Dumm to the position of Bedroom and Bedding Buyer. David has been managing stores for Wolf’s for 20 years, and most recently he was the General Manager of the Frederick, Maryland store. “We are pleased to be able to promote from within again,” said Doug Wolf.

“David has done a terrific job at the store management level and displays the skills needed for success in this corporate buying position.”

David, wife Wendy, and 2 children, Courtney and Chloe, plan on moving to the Altoona area.
